32 killed, 80 injured in Nigeria explosion

Author : NewsGram Desk

Lagos: At least 32 people were killed and 80 injured on Tuesday in a bomb explosion that rocked the north east part of Nigeria.

Security sources told Xinhua that the blast rocked a motor park in Yola, the Adamawa State capital at about 8 p.m. when the place was crowded with food sellers and petty traders.

Saadu Bello, an official of the National Emergency Management Agency (NEMA), put the death toll at 32 while 80 got injured.
